Job description

The Role

You'll own the backend, data, and infrastructure that deliver Forager's data to platform customers at scale - from ingestion all the way through to the APIs and feeds customers integrate against. This is a backend-first role: most of your time is spent building API features, operating our search and ETL data infrastructure, and owning the DevOps and platform layer underneath it. You'll also contribute to our customer-facing React/TypeScript web app, but that's the minority of the work. This is a senior, high-ownership role on a small team. You won't just contribute features - you'll be responsible for the design, reliability, and evolution of the platform itself. You'll have direct input into product direction and the freedom (and responsibility) to ship work that materially moves our coverage, accuracy, latency, and uptime metrics.

What You'll Own
  • Backend & API development - real-time enrichment APIs (person/org lookup, contact data, reverse search), search and filter endpoints, waterfall enrichment logic, and the credit/billing surfaces customers meter against. Match rate, latency, and freshness directly drive customer value.
  • Data engineering, ETL & search infrastructure - own the Elasticsearch/ECK stack end-to-end (index and mapping design, ingestion pipelines, relevance tuning, cluster health, scaling, migrations), plus the ETL applications that move billions of data points daily into searchable stores, Snowflake data products, and warehouse exports while holding fill rates and accuracy.
  • DevOps & platform (core owner) - you own day-to-day AWS infrastructure, infrastructure-as-code, CI/CD, and observability. This is not shared-on-the-side ops: you're responsible for infrastructure modernization, deployment pipelines, security scanning, log/metric consolidation, and the reliability of the systems you build.
  • Observability & data‑quality tooling - build Grafana dashboards, load tests, and data-accuracy evals that make coverage, freshness, latency, and correctness measurable and continuously monitored across the data‑quality surface.
  • Customer-facing web app (minority) - contribute to the React/TypeScript app, docs, onboarding, and self‑serve surfaces when the work calls for it.
Core Responsibilities
  • Backend & API Development Design, build, and operate RESTful APIs for enrichment, search, feeds, and platform-customer workflows. Develop scalable backend services - workers, task queues, waterfall lookups, data pipelines - that keep refresh cycles predictable and fill rates high. Build the metering, credit-logging, and billing logic that customers rely on for accurate consumption. Participate actively in product planning; help shape which features have the highest customer impact.
  • Data Engineering, Search & ETL Own the Elasticsearch / ECK search stack end‑to‑end: index design, ingestion, relevance, cluster health, scaling, and migrations. Design and operate ETL applications moving data into searchable stores, bulk feeds, and warehouses ( Snowflake , S3). Optimize PostgreSQL - query performance, indexing, cache utilization. Drive measurable improvements in latency, uptime, error rate, fill rate, and scalability.
  • DevOps & Infrastructure (Core Owner) Own AWS infrastructure (ECS, S3, etc.) and infrastructure-as-code. Own CI/CD pipelines. Own observability - Grafana, CloudWatch, Sentry - and on‑call response for the surfaces you build. Drive infrastructure modernization and share crawler infrastructure maintenance with the team.
  • Collaboration & Quality Code review with high standards for readability, security, and performance. Write unit, integration, and E2E tests - test reliability is a quality contributor, not overhead. Document features, architecture, and API contracts; great developer docs are how our customers succeed.
What We’re Looking For
  • Required Experience 5+ years building and operating production backend systems and APIs, with clear examples of strategic technical problem‑solving (not just tenure). Strong proficiency in Python / Django REST Framework . Hands‑on experience operating Elasticsearch / OpenSearch at scale - index/mapping design, query and relevance tuning, cluster management, migrations. Demonstrated track record building and operating ETL pipelines that move significant data volumes reliably. Production experience with PostgreSQL , Redis , and async task systems ( Celery / RabbitMQ or equivalent). Core‑owner-level comfort with AWS (ECS, S3, CloudWatch), infrastructure‑as‑code , and CI/CD (GitHub Actions or equivalent) - you're comfortable owning the platform, not just deploying to it. Experience operating services in production - observability, on‑call, incident response. Working proficiency in React / TypeScript - comfortable shipping product UI when the work calls for it. (This is the minority of the role, not its center.) Strong written communication; comfortable owning documentation as a deliverable.
